Can I jog along the beaches in Pará?

Absolutely! Pará is famous for its freshwater beaches, such as those in Alter do Chão (like Ilha do Amor), Salinópolis (Atalaia, Espadarte, Maçarico beaches), and Marajó Island (Joanes Beach). These offer expansive, often firm sand surfaces perfect for beach running, especially during the dry season when they are most prominent.

What is the best time of year for running in Pará?

Pará experiences a tropical climate. The dry season, typically from July to December, might offer more comfortable conditions for running, especially on beaches which are more prominent then. However, the lush environment means high humidity is common year-round. Early mornings or late afternoons are generally best to avoid the midday heat.

What should I wear for jogging in Pará's climate?

Given Pará's tropical climate with high humidity and heat, it's advisable to wear lightweight, breathable, moisture-wicking clothing. Sun protection, such as a hat and sunscreen, is also crucial. Hydration is key, so carrying water or planning routes with access to water is recommended.
